1. Coconut oil as a natural conditioner
Because of its texture, aroma, and properties, coconut oil is a great alternative to replace commercial conditioners. It does not contain aggressive chemicals and is full of vitamins, minerals, and proteins that strengthen the roots.
Ingredients
Two tablespoons coconut oil (30 g)
How to use it?
- The application can be made during the usual washing of the hair, or as a deep dry treatment.
- Take a couple of tablespoons of coconut oil and rub it all over your hair and scalp.
- Cover it with a bathing cap and let it act for an hour.
- Wash with plenty of water and proceed to comb immediately.

3. Treatment against dandruff
The antimicrobial and antifungal properties of coconut oil used as a solution against excess dandruff and its symptoms. Its application soothes irritation, reduces peeling, and relieves the uncomfortable itching sensation. Its fatty-acid composition also stops the fungal infection and eliminates this problem at the root.
Ingredients
Two tablespoons coconut oil (30 g)
Five drops of tea tree essential oil
How to use it?
- Combine the essential oils until you get a homogeneous product.
- Apply it all over the scalp and hair with gentle circular massages.
- Cover it with a hat and let it act for 20 or 30 minutes.
- Rinse and repeat your application every three days.
